FIVE HUNTERS ARRESTED FOR TORTURING TEENAGER TO DEATH OVET N20, 000.(PHOTO).


 Five hunters arrested for torturing teenager to death over N20,000


Five hunters have been arrested in connection with the killing of a 14-year-old teenager in Maiha local government area of Adamawa State.

The suspects were alleged to have tortured the victim on suspicion that he stole N20,000.

A statement from the state Police Public Relations Officer, Suleiman Nguroje, said they were arrested on Wednesday, June 5, “for the unlawful arrest and torture” of the teenager who they accused of stealing the 20,000.

“The suspects are currently under investigation and would be charged to court for the law to take its course,” the Police statement said.

The Commissioner of Police, CP Dakonmbo Morris, who condemned the actions of the hunters, warned members of the public against taking the law into their own hands.
